Windows 8.1 (unlike Windows 8) does not support the creation of a CD or DVD repair disc, although you can use your Windows 8.1 distribution media as a repair disc. With Windows 8.1, if your system supports booting from a USB drive, you should create a USB recovery drive instead.

When troubleshooting DirectAccess connectivity issues on Windows 8.x clients you may find the option to generate advanced troubleshooting logs missing. On Windows 8 clients, the Collect Logs button will be grayed out. On Windows 8.1 clients it will be missing altogether. Windows 8. Mar 28, 2014 · Windows 8.1 Troubleshooters. Before I show you some of the troubleshooters, let’s see how to get to them in Windows 8.1. First, open the Charms bar by pressing Windows key + C or moving your mouse to the upper or lower right of your screen.
